#86f361 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#86f361 is composed of 52.5% red, 95.3%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.1%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 104.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 66.7%. #86f361 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c2 with #0de700.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

Shades and Tints of #86f361

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020600 is the darkest color, while #f6fef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#86f361

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9aba9 is the less saturated color, while #83fa5a is the most saturated one.
